About This Community
Owners at Spring Brooke HOA pay about $375 per month ($4,500 annually) in HOA dues. The community is a planned development in Goshen, IN (ZIP 46528). On-site facilities: Playground, Walking Trails. Long-term rentals are allowed; short-term / Airbnb-style rentals are not. The community is pet-friendly.

Pet Restrictions
Dogs must be leashed, designated dog park available
Parking Rules
2 vehicles per unit, guest parking available
